Memento Mori Ceramics

Ngāti Porou Ngāti Kahungunu

At the base of Maungatautari mountain in Cambridge, Memento Mori Ceramics is where Tonia Geddes and Lee Johnston bring their passion for art, ceramics, and living life fully to life. Guided by the Latin phrase memento mori | carpe diem, the duo are reminded to live boldly and with purpose, creating unique ceramic pieces that celebrate both art and sustainable living.

Their small studio is not only where they craft their beautiful ceramicware but also where they share their love of ceramics with the community through workshops, fostering connection and creativity.

Our Journey Together

After more than 20 years in the film industry’s Art Departments, Lee felt the need for a more fulfilling, creative path. Inspired by the ceramicware created for The Hobbit film production, he embarked on a new journey with Tonia. Tonia, with her Bachelor of Fine Arts from Canterbury University and a background as a Visual Arts teacher and art gallery director, joined Lee to explore the world of clay. Together, they designed their first ceramics and began their journey in the pottery world.

In their collaboration, Lee shapes the pieces on the wheel, while Tonia applies her painting skills, preps and glazes the bisqueware, and incorporates hand-building techniques. Their joint efforts result in pieces that reflect both their expertise and shared vision.

Our Studio and Inspiration

Memento Mori Ceramics is based in their country studio nestled at the foot of Maungatautari mountain in the beautiful Waikato region. For Lee, it was a return to his hometown of Cambridge, while Tonia found new inspiration in the area. Their whakaruruhau (shelter) is both a place of peace and creativity, offering the perfect environment for crafting ceramics that reflect the natural beauty and tranquil spirit of the region.

Their Philosophy

At Memento Mori Ceramics, the philosophy of living life intentionally and with passion is at the heart of everything the team does. The Latin phrase memento mori serves as a reminder to appreciate each fleeting moment, guiding their creative process. Each ceramic piece they craft is more than just an object—it’s an invitation for others to embrace life fully, appreciate the present, and connect with the beauty of the world around them.
